Morning
Take a day trip to the nearby city of Jerez de la Frontera, which is famous for its sherry wine and flamenco dancing. Visit one of the local bodegas, such as Bodegas Lustau or Bodegas Gonz lez Byass, and learn about the production of sherry wine.
Afternoon
After the wine tasting, visit the Royal Andalusian School of Equestrian Art and watch a live performance of classical dressage. Marvel at the beauty and grace of the horses as they perform intricate movements to the sound of classical music.
